SolarWinds Web Help Desk vulnerability
SolarWinds Web Help Desk contains a deserialization vulnerability in AjaxProxy allowing remote code execution on affected systems.
Verdict
Today item — known-exploited.
An attacker can exploit unsafe deserialization of untrusted data in the AjaxProxy component to execute arbitrary commands with the privileges of the Web Help Desk service, potentially compromising the host system.

Weakness (CWE)
Mapped to CWE-502 Deserialization of Untrusted Data — weakness family: Injection.CWE — CNA-assigned (CVE.org); the weakness class drives how the flaw is exploited.
